LoonaGlow wrote a review...
this was a pretty solid murder mystery. i had lots of guesses for who who the killer was ( even reese herself), but my guess was completely wrong.
this was dark and twisty and full of suspense, yet emotional at times. i loved how it portrayed teen angst and the dangers of the internet culture in modern times.
my only complaint was courtney was frustrating and bland at times. i wish she felt properly developed.
